Failure to return funds
On Friday November 20, 2009, I went to the internet to pay my Bank of America mortgage payment for November, formerly Countrywide Mortgage. I entered all the correct information and hit the submit button (which you are supposed to hit only once). Well, I did hit “submit” but nothing happened – no confirmation – nothing. I waited and waited. Finally it was apparent to me that something was wrong. So I closed out, checked my account for the deduction – there was none – and then went back and tried over again. Same results. Frustrated, I called Bank of America and told the associate I shouldn’t be charged for over the phone payment since their website wasn’t working. She apologized and stated that with the transfer from Countrywide to Bank of America, they have been experiencing “technical problems” but would be happy to assist me in getting my payment in. This was only the beginning of my problems with B of A.

The next day, I checked my account and lo and behold there were TWO mortgage payments deducted from my account! I only wanted ONE. I never gave instructions to have two deducted from my account. Obviously some error occurred – most likely at the website. So Monday I called, spending 45 minutes before finally reaching the right party to assist me. I was sent to the Payment Research Dept, where I talked to Sharon. After a lengthy discussion, she told me it was approved for reversal and that it would be DEPOSITED BACK INTO MY ACCOUNT WITHIN 72 HOURS. That would make it Thursday, but being a holiday I shouldn’t see it until Friday. Ha, Ha, Ha…. And so begins the string of lies/deception/whatever I was given regarding my money.

On Tuesday November 24, I received another confirmation from Bank of America which I erroneously thought was another payment notification. (I was told on Monday that I should have 2 confirmations but I only had one so naturally when I saw B of A confirmation, I assumed it was for the second payment withdrawn on the 20th.) Now not knowing what is going on, my thinking was oh no, they deducted another payment! What is going on? So I contacted the bank again. I was assured that no further mortgage payments were deducted. I told the associate that this 72 hour business was totally unacceptable. Monies were withdrawn IMMEDIATELY but crediting my account back would be 72 hours???? No no no. The associate then told me that the money goes to the “Federal Reserve” and it is difficult to get the money back and that is why the time frame. Again, I found this unacceptable, but had NO CHOICE. In other words, “tough luck lady”.

On Wednesday, November 25, there was still no money in my account. So I called again --- going through tons of hoops and holds, only to have the connection lost during one of the phone “transfers”. By now I was completely agitated so decided to stop in person at a BofA banking center and have a one-on-one assistance. I went to the Massaponex Banking Center in Fredricksburg VA and talked with Doris, who went hoops to assist me. After about 40 minutes, she assured me that I had been approved by the Payment Research Dept and I would see my money in my account either after midnight (Thursday) or first thing on Friday.

Neither Thursday nor Friday gave any results. So around 11:30 am I called Doris and asked her to please, please find out what is going on. She was reluctant and stated why didn’t I just do the calling. (See above). It was somewhere around 3:30 – 4 pm before I heard back from her. Basically she could do nothing and I’d either have to call myself or just wait.

Back to the Payment Research Dept where I finally connected with another associate (she was very nice considering I could hardly talk because I was in complete tears) but now I was told that the bank was short handed all week and my approval just sat there. It would be credited to my account asap as she was putting a “rush” on this. Well, Saturday no money. Monday no money. It is now 10 days from taking my money making it impossible for me to use and left with the feeling I was being given the run around. First thought, oh, it’s the end of the month --- hmmmm reports need to be done. Gee, if they did this to say, another 500, 000 or even 5, 000 people, imagine the amount of money B of A is getting to use!

Well, I created a list of contacts to file a complaint on Bank of America. However, I thought I’d give it one more chance. I called the B of A Center in Central Park, Fredericksburg, VA where I talked to a very nice and understanding manager – Keith. He apologized and agreed that I was treated unjustly. He stated since my Friday conversation was after 2 pm, and that the associate said she’d put a “rush” on it, I should definitely see my money back in my account by Tuesday, December 1 (today).

Guess what! Nothing! It is now 11 days later and I still don’t have my money back. Customer service is ABHORRANT!

Overdraft Charges
My account went $250 in the hole due to the bank holding charges they said had already cleared. As soon as I saw that my account was in the red I called there corporate office and explained what happened the person on the end of the phone told me to put money in to clear up the negative and call tomorrow and they would help out with the overdraft fees.

Day 2: I look at my account and they have charged me 3 $35 overdraft fees, leaving my account $-45.00. So I call and they remove 2 of the three fees. leaving $24.00 in my account. They put a note on my account to try to stop any more fees.

Day 3: So I look at my account first thing in the morning again and this time I am $-95.00, 3 more fees have come thru. These fees are for the items that bounced because of yesterdays fees that were refunded. So I call extremely upset and speak to a rep. who reverses two of the fees, but I asked to speak to a supervisor. She comes on the line and I explain to her whats going on and she reverses the last fee. Leaving $11.00 in my account. There was one pending transaction that I had already been charged an overdraft fee on, I asked the supervisor if another fee was going to go thru; she said if it did call back again tomorrow.

Day 4: The first thing I do is check my account and low and behold there is another overdraft fee. So I call again and the first person I talk to is rude and states they won't do anything else. My account is $-21.00 in the hole today. She won't let me speak and tells me this is all my fault. So I hang up on her and I call back. The next teller is the same and say again that no they can't fix it. I ask to speak to a supervisor and she does not connect me. She tries to tell me these are all new fees. I am looking at my account on line and this fee is for the same fee they refunded yesterday and then charged again.

So I am sure I will get another fee tomorrow for that same transaction. I refuse to pay it and I will be closing my account today. This is a scam they have refunded and recharged me for 4days on the same transaction. I am a single mom and can't afford to play this game. I suggest anyone who has an account with BoA TO CLOSE IT IMMEDIATLY.

Escrow Account - Insureance Payment
Bank of America was suppose to paid my Home Owners Insurance on 9/14/09; on 10/14/09 I received a letter from AAA stating no payment had been received. BoA said they would place a stop payment on the check on 10/15/09 and send out a new check. On 10/27/09 I had to pay for my insurance via a credit card and BoA informed me that a stop payment had not been issued but the check had been sent to research and it would take 10-15 days to be completed. And, they set me up with their own insuance that would cost more. On 11/3/09 BoA was waiting for the funds to be deposited back into my Escrow account and a check would be sent to me. BoA would call me by Friday, 11/6/09 to confirm payment. Spoke with BoA on 11/12/09 they are still waiting for the funds to be deposited and it could take 30-90 days before I would receive a check. No supervisor would talk to me and still has not called me. Let's see, check was issued by BoA, stopped by BoA, and they received the funds with in 24 hours but it takes 90 days to send to me.
